#f567b9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f567b9 is composed of 96.1% red, 40.4%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58% magenta, 24.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 325.4 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 68.2%. #f567b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ffceff with #eb0073.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#f567b9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f567b9 has RGB values of R:245, G:103,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.24,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16082873.

Shades and Tints of #f567b9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0108 is the darkest color, while #fffaf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f567b9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0acae is the less saturated color, while #fb61ba is the most saturated one.
